WALL-E is, at its heart, a story about the remnants of human culture. The titular robot spends his centuries-long isolation collecting physical artifacts—VHS tapes, sporks, and Rubik’s cubes—to maintain a connection to a lost civilization. When users turn to sites like Filmyzilla to download a compressed, often low-quality rip of this film, they are participating in a modern version of WALL-E’s scavenging. However, where WALL-E preserves the soul of the object, the "pirate-site" experience strips the film of its cinematic grandeur, reducing a visual symphony of high-definition textures and lighting into a disposable file. In this desolate world, WALL-E (Waste Allocation Load Lifter Earth-Class), a small waste-collecting robot, is left behind to clean up the planet. WALL-E's days are filled with compressing trash into cubes and building towering skyscrapers out of them. The robot's existence is one of solitude, with only a cockroach as his companion.
